summ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Timo Eskola <timo@tolleri.net>2018-08-31 09:03:39 +0300
committerTimo Eskola <timo@tolleri.net>2018-08-31 09:03:39 +0300
commit6956a767b70e155791a153a773ef8c46243965ed (patch)
treef7b530d2dda95e1cab2e3d6a317937e5efe128b8
parent4b0ca40aa424e39c843f63d27807695aa736b610 (diff)
downloadvdr-plugin-duplicates-6956a767b70e155791a153a773ef8c46243965ed.tar.gz
vdr-plugin-duplicates-6956a767b70e155791a153a773ef8c46243965ed.tar.bz2
Updated kNone handling in main menu.
-rw-r--r--menu.c18
1 files changed, 10 insertions, 8 deletions
diff --git a/menu.c b/menu.c
index 94871ac..0a5300f 100644
--- a/menu.c
+++ b/menu.c
@@ -443,18 +443,20 @@ eOSState cMenuDuplicates::ProcessKey(eKeys Key) {
case kOk:
case kInfo: return Info();
case kBlue: return ToggleHidden();
- default: break;
- }
- }
- if (!HasSubMenu()) {
+ case kNone:
#if VDRVERSNUM >= 20301
- if (cRecordings::GetRecordingsRead(recordingsStateKey)) {
- recordingsStateKey.Remove();
+ if (cRecordings::GetRecordingsRead(recordingsStateKey)) {
+ recordingsStateKey.Remove();
#else
- if (Recordings.StateChanged(recordingsState)) {
+ if (Recordings.StateChanged(recordingsState)) {
#endif
- Set(true);
+ Set(true);
+ }
+ break;
+ default: break;
}
+ }
+ if (!HasSubMenu()) {
if (Key != kNone)
SetHelpKeys();
}